You'll need to use an UnmarshalXML func for the params: // Param is a tag w/ any name type Param struct { Namestring `xml:"-"` Typestring `xml:"type,attr"` MinOccurs int`xml:"minOccurs,attr"` MaxOccurs int`xml:"maxOccurs,attr"` Description string `xml:"description"` } // ParamList type for unmarhsal type ParamList []Param // UnmarshalXML for the win func (pl *ParamList) UnmarshalXML(d *xml.Decoder, s xml.StartElement) error { tk, err := d.Token() for err == nil { switch t := tk.(type) { case xml.StartElement: param := Param{Name: t.Name.Local} if err = d.DecodeElement(, ); err != nil { return err } *pl = append(*pl, param) } if tk, err = d.Token(); err == io.EOF { return nil } } return err } // TopLevel is of course top level type TopLevel struct { Description string `xml:"description"` Rights Rights `xml:"rights"` Method []Method `xml:"method"` } // Method has request type Method struct { Namestring `xml:"name,attr"` Description string `xml:"description"` Rights []Right `xml:"rights"` Request Request `xml:"request"` ResponseResponse `xml:"response"` } // Right whatever type Right struct { Right string `xml:"right"` } // Request like Response type Request struct { Params ParamList `xml:"params"` } // Response like Request type Response struct { Params ParamList `xml:"params"` } // Rights type Rights struct { PrivLevel string `xml:"privLevel"` } On Wednesday, October 18, 2017 at 11:50:45 AM UTC-4, Jeffrey Smith wrote: > > I have a lot of XML documents that have sections in that contain tags that > can be of any name but will contain type,minOccurs,maxOccurs and have a > description inside it. For instance name,description,definition and id > below. > > > > > > description number1 > > user > > > graphCreate API > > > > > A friendly name to identify the graph > > > Detailed description of the graph > > > Specify the graph definition. i.e how this graph > should be built. > > > > > > > graph identifier. > > > > > > > Whats the best way to parse this. So far I have but can't work out how to > dynamically generate the struct to stuff this into.
